Output 07529c8895155cc3ee65bbb3d22e6f5237c397914f45c6e4478cb9a31c447427:0

value
36013075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d3039f36ac97c1b03e51e683b7590ccdf1f352a OP_EQUAL
address
3D6xAME3iBV98kqQ41DQ6aP8jxUMK1N6KX
transaction
07529c8895155cc3ee65bbb3d22e6f5237c397914f45c6e4478cb9a31c447427
spent
true